Q: Is 4,104,906 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 4,104,906 is not a prime number.

Why is 4,104,906 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 4104906 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 13 26 39 78 52,627 105,254 157,881 315,762 684,151 1,368,302 2,052,453 and 4,104,906, with no remainder.

Since 4,104,906 cannot be divided by just 1 and 4,104,906, it is not a prime number.
